This from the pdf referenced by KC:

Interesting their ad says good  to 600yds. According to "The Smokeless Powders of Laflin & Rand and Their Fate 100 Years  After Assimilation by Dupont" by Klaus Neuschaefer 2007,  Marksmen was introduced in 1904 as a reduced load "gallery" powder for rifles and L&R's only single based powder. It was renamed to Dupont Gallery Rifle #75 in 1907 when  L&R was purchased by Dupont and discontinued in 1928.
